Launch of FCT- IRS e-portal debuts ease, efficiency services for taxpayers in Abuja – FCT – IRS

By Joyce Remi-Babayeju

The Federal Capital Territory, FCT-, Internal Revenue Service, FCT- IRS, Executive Chairman, Haruna Abdullahi has said that the launch of the FCT- IRS e- portal will bring ease , efficient services for taxpayers in the comfort of thier homes.

Speaking on Tuesday in Abuja, Abdullahi who was represented by Director , Tax Department, Mrs. Chinwe Ndu said, ” gone are the days of cumbersome paperwork and long waiting times. Instead, we are welcoming a new era where taxpayers can navigate their obligations with ease and efficiency, all at the click of a button from the comfort of their homes or offices.”
He explained that the e-portal platform is an innovation, ” that will help us bridge the gap between tradition and modernity, propelling tax management further into the digital age.”
He said that the FCT-IRS has made significant progress overtime towards revolutionizing revenue management and collection for taxpayers.

” The e-portal is our collection, receipting, assessment, and Tax Clearance Certificate, TCC, issuance platform with the embedding of every service of revenue management.”
” This platform is a symphony of evolution of processes, seamlessly harmonizing convenience, transparency, and accountability.”
Speaking further, he stated that
the platform harnesses the power of technology to enable both taxpayers and tax administrators to interact in a transparent, efficient, and user-friendly manner.”
He noted that the tax e- portal is designed meticulously to meet the needs and expectations of individual taxpayer, business owners, and tax consultants.

Furthermore, he emphasized that the FCT- IRS e- portal platform offering the promotion of ease of doing business within the FCT, enhancement of accessibility to important tax-related services, simplified and streamlined tax services among other things.

On the part of the Technical Partner, CEO , AutoCom Services, Bosun Ayeni congratulated the IRS for their step in bringing innovation to Tax collection and expressed optimism that in the mist spending a lot of money on recoveries and chasing after collection of monies from taxpayers, the service will add Artificial Intelligence, AI, will show what new technologies will be doing for FCT- IRS.
